Transaction 58a37436230f88150aa317a9290c2706e783857f4eedb05af30da877302df6f8
1 Input
1 Output
-
58a37436230f88150aa317a9290c2706e783857f4eedb05af30da877302df6f8:0
- value
- 209181
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cec47c9a595750b60a5504ce7a747594bb0bfe13 OP_EQUAL
- address
- 3LYJWCSuDhMevZpiuBf8Rzar2RkEVM41ha